Some advanced beds are furnished with columns which help turn the bed to 1530 levels on each side. Such tilting can aid prevent pressure ulcers for the person, and help caregivers to do their day-to-day jobs with much less of a threat of back injuries. Hospital Beds For Home Use. Tires allow simple movement of the bed, either within components of the center in which they are situated, or within the space




Wheels are lockable. For safety, wheels can be secured when transferring the patient in or out of the bed. Medicare will certainly also assist to cover the expense of some bed accessories, which might include trapeze bars, bed mattress covers that are intended to avoid bedsores, and bedside rails. As opposed to buy a home medical facility bed directly out, one can likewise rent out a health center bed and still receive economic support from Medicare.

It is essential to note, Medicare will certainly not cover the cost of complete electric beds. One can pay the distinction out-of-pocket in between a manual-lift bed and a completely electric one. In addition, Medicare only covers a basic bed, meaning a form very comparable to a twin bed, yet not identical.

Since Medicaid is a joint federal and state program, with each state running the program as they choose within the standards set forth by the federal government, policies and laws about long lasting clinical devices (DME) such as home hospital beds, is not constant throughout the states.


Both State Plans and Waivers supply assistance to help the senior avoid nursing home positioning. Medicaid really frequently will cover the cost of DME, which includes home health center beds.


(TFL), an additional clinical insurance coverage for retired experts, helps to cover the prices for those signed up in Medicare that are not covered by Medicare. (CFL) uses the same benefit.


TRICARE, likewise for retired vets, likewise covers healthcare facility beds (both leased and bought), given they have been prescribed by a physician. One may make a reduction from their federal income tax obligations in the event they buy a required home health center bed for themselves, their spouse or various other reliant.


The complying with examples presume the tax filer has nothing else clinical expenditures for the year. The tax filer can subtract the price of the bed that is over 10% of their adjusted gross income. If part of the bed was covered by insurance coverage, the tax filer would only have the ability to subtract the component that was paid out-of-pocket.

The rate of a semi-electric bed typically begins at around $1,000. The size of a common medical facility bed from the top of the bed to the base of the bed is 38" width by 84" size, with the sleep surface being 36" size by 80" long.






There are likewise complete dimension hospital beds, which are 54" large by 80" long, queen size beds that are 60" vast by 80" long, and economy size beds that are 76" wide by 80" long. On top of that, there are click for source also bariatric beds that can additional resources be found in a larger width of 48".


Home health center beds need sheets that are especially made for this kind of bed. This is because a normal medical facility bed is the size of a twin bed in width, however is much longer in size. One should anticipate to pay about $50 for a set of sheets for a standard home hospital bed.
